为了账号安全,请及时绑定邮箱和手机立即绑定

这个好像没问题但是为什么说不行呢?

#include <stdio.h>

/* 考虑一下哪个输出该用无参函数哪个输出该用有参函数呢? */

int mooc1()

{

    printf("%s\n","小明在幕课网上学习");

    return 0;

    }

int mooc2(int n)

{

    printf("小明在幕课网上学习了%d\n门课程",n);

    return 0;

}




int main()

{

int mooc1();

int mooc2(3);

    return 0;

}


正在回答

3 回答

第一个代码块中没有定义字符就不需要加“%s"直接利用输出韩函数直接输出就是啦!最后是调用函数所以不需要加数据类型,三个分号改成英文分号就可以!

0 回复 有任何疑惑可以回复我~

main里的函数前面不用加int

1 回复 有任何疑惑可以回复我~
#1

qq_fullautomati_03152149 提问者

这个定义是要的
2016-04-14 回复 有任何疑惑可以回复我~

有些" ; "你是用中文打出来的

0 回复 有任何疑惑可以回复我~
#1

qq_fullautomati_03152149 提问者

是发现了,中英文切换很容易造成这个。你有好的解决办法吗?
2016-04-14 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

这个好像没问题但是为什么说不行呢?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信